Output e125dbd30fab4126094ae764490fbf74d0a4035aece418dbf8f34bc9a9d246fc:1

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 563ef86d5731c6408c0c0a424300e9f5ed921013 OP_EQUALVERIFY OP_CHECKSIG
address
18s2Ym1a79UV3stCk5hrB6dS5vCJHRAKUN
transaction
e125dbd30fab4126094ae764490fbf74d0a4035aece418dbf8f34bc9a9d246fc
confirmations
575812
spent
true